What is Quest Recovery Manager?

Quest Recovery Manager for Active Directory Disaster Recovery Edition revolutionizes the recovery of an Active Directory (AD) forest, drastically reducing downtime from what could span weeks to just a few hours. This powerful solution offers a variety of backup options, such as comprehensive server backups and system state backups, alongside flexible recovery techniques including phased recovery, restoration to a new operating system, and bare metal recovery. It ensures the protection of AD backups through multiple storage alternatives, featuring cloud options like Azure Blob and AWS S3, and includes a Secure Storage server designed to shield against ransomware with air-gapped safeguards. Moreover, the software is equipped with built-in malware detection and removal capabilities powered by Microsoft's Defender, significantly reducing the risk of reinfection throughout the recovery process. Recovery Manager also streamlines the recovery workflow with automated phased recovery, allowing for the swift restoration of critical domain controllers to promptly resume essential business functions, followed by the methodical redeployment of other controllers. All these functionalities render it a crucial asset for organizations aiming to maintain resilience and operational continuity within their Active Directory ecosystems, ensuring they can effectively navigate potential disasters.

What is IBM Storage Defender?

Anticipate a significant improvement in data resilience in the near future. It is crucial to vigilantly monitor, protect, identify, and restore information across both primary and secondary storage environments. IBM Storage Defender plays a vital role in this landscape by proactively pinpointing threats and ensuring a rapid and secure restoration of your operations in the event of an attack. This tool is an integral part of the IBM Storage suite designed specifically for enhancing data resilience. By leveraging AI-driven insights from IBM, the Storage Defender not only provides visibility throughout your entire storage framework but also adeptly detects threats such as ransomware and identifies the most secure recovery pathways. This solution integrates effortlessly with your existing security operations to guarantee an expedited recovery process.
